The Ridge Behavioral Health System is a 110-bed hospital located in the heart of the Bluegrass, Lexington, KY. The Ridge provides psychiatric and substance use disorder treatment for children, adolescents, and adults. The Ridge offers Partial Hospitalization, Intensive Outpatient Programs, Individual Counseling, as well as Medication Management for all ages. We have provided behavioral health services to over 92 Kentucky counties for more than 39 years.
Leads recovery groups to provide mentoring and goal setting. Promoting skill building and resources.
Job Duties Include:
- Assists peers to investigate, select, and use needed and desired resources and services
- Uses respectful, person-centered, recovery-oriented language in written and verbal interactions with peers, family members, community members, and others
- Assertively engages providers from mental health services, addiction services, and physical medicine to meet the needs of peers

Qualifications:Education
- High School Diploma or GED required
- Prior experience as a Peer Support Specialist
- Prior experience in leading recovery groups
- Narcan training
- 2 years sobriety
- Peer Support Specialist Certification
- Valid Driver's License
